xenial-black
xenial-black7mo ago

How can I get all records that were created this calender month.

I would like to get the amount of records that were created this month after calling useTable.
3 Replies
kapa.ai
kapa.ai7mo ago
Hi @blackbearftw.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ave: ---------------------- Hmm, I don't know enough to give you a confident answer yet. However, you can use the filters feature of the useTable hook to filter your data based on the createdAt field. You would need to set up a filter that checks if the createdAt date of each record is within the current calendar month. Unfortunately, the exact implementation would depend on the format of your createdAt field and the capabilities of your server-side filtering logic. For more information on how to use filters with useTable, you can check out the refine documentation (https://refine.dev/docs/core/hooks/use-table#filtering). ---------------------- Note: you can ask me a follow up question by @ mentioning me again :speech_balloon: ----------------------
kapa.ai
kapa.ai7mo ago
<@490961337896402944> kapa.ai is still learning and improving, please let us know how it did by reacting below
continuing-cyan
continuing-cyan7mo ago
Hello @blackbearftw you can pass filters to your data hook (useTable, useList etc..) to get events created this month. If you want to get total count of events created this month, it depends on your API response. You can handle API response in your data provider.